Young cyclists sprint past veterans in Delta event

Published: Thursday, August 19, 2010

HA NOI — Youth prevailed in the fifth stage of the 19th Mekong Delta Cycling Tour, An Giang Plant Protection Cup, yesterday.

Nguyen Hoang Sang of the An Giang Plant Protection youth team completed the 116km race from Soc Trang city to Ca Mau city in 2hr 40min 34sec at a top speed of 43.346km/h.

Second and third went to Nguyen Minh Tam and Nguyen Hoang Sang from ADC-Vinh Long Television 2.

Veterans of Sai Gon Plant Protection found the competition tough. Nguyen Nam Cuc from Sai Gon Plant Protection 2 kept the yellow jersey for a best overall 14:30.33 after five stages, followed by Dang Trung Hieu of Can Tho city and Lam Cong Danh of An Giang Plant Protection.

Keeping the green jersey for the highest points in the tournament, Do Tuan Anh from Domesco Dong Thap has 62 points. Mai Nguyen Hung of Sai Gon Plant Protection 1 was runner-up with 54 points.

In team ranking, Sai Gon Plant Protection 2 maintained the lead with a total time of 43:39.44, followed by ADC-Vinh Long Television with 43:42.23 and Military Zone 7 43:42.28.

Today, cyclists will compete in the 180km penultimate and longest stage from Ca Mau city to Can Tho city. Competition for the green jersey will be strong among veterans Anh, Hung and Nguyen Truong Tai of Domesco Dong Thap. — VNS
